What You'll Do

As a Bulk Material Transfer Operator, you will safely connect equipment and transfer materials between railcars and trucks. You will follow established operating procedures to protect employees, customer products, equipment, and the surrounding environment.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Connecting and disconnecting transfer hoses, pumps, valves, and related equipment
  • Transferring bulk materials between railcars and tank trucks
  • Inspecting hoses, fittings, railcars, and equipment before and after each transfer
  • Monitoring transfer operations and reporting leaks, damage, or unusual conditions
  • Climbing railcars and working safely from elevated platforms
  • Wearing required personal protective equipment, including specialized PPE when necessary
  • Maintaining accurate operating records and completing required documentation
  • Keeping the work area clean, organized, and free from safety hazards
  • Following all company, customer, environmental, and industry safety procedures
  • Assisting coworkers with additional terminal duties as assigned
